SCHEDULEREMOVAL OR ALTERATION OF PHYSICAL FEATURES: DESIGN STANDARDS

Definition of “relevant design standard”

1.—(1) Subject to sub-paragraph (2), a physical feature, in relation to a building situated in Northern Ireland, satisfies the relevant design standard for the purposes of regulation 12(2) where it accords with Technical Booklet R and Technical Booklet V: 2000.

(2) However, a physical feature does not satisfy the relevant design standard where more than 10 years have elapsed since—

(a)the day on which the construction or installation of the feature was completed; or

(b)in the case of a physical feature provided as part of a larger building project, the day on which the works in relation to that project were completed.
